2230010 - How to Request an Instance Index/Re-index in Recruiting Management

Resolution

Note: The initial index is no longer required as once the RCM module is enabled, the index is automatically created.

Changes to the Candidate Profile:

  • Uploading the Candidate profile XML or changing it does not require a instance reindex.
  • Changes to the candidate profile will rarely require a re-indexing of the search index.
  • Only the following changes to the candidate profile template may require a re-index:
    • After an import of new candidates thru legacy import (Check KB article 2279481 for more detail)
    • Changing the field type of a field (Not recommended) 
    • Issues with the search tab or search results. (Product Support can validate if the reindex is necessary)

IMPORTANT: Changing the field type of a field is not recommended for live customers, as it can cause application errors on existing records, storing data that does not match the new field type.

How to request an re-index:

In order to request a re-index, please open a Support case with the following MANDATORY information:

  • Company ID
  • Data Center
  • Reason for the request

IMPORTANT:

If this information is not provided, the support Team is not able proceed with the request.
